现在的位置: 首页 > 综合 > 正文

[Jobdu] 1324: The Best Rank & 1007: 奥运排序问题 & 1009: 二叉搜索树

2013年09月11日 ⁄ 综合 ⁄ 共 426字 ⁄ 字号 评论关闭

1324和1007两道题是一个类型的,解题时遇到好多自身存在的问题,所以有必要记录一下。。。

1)malloc二维数组的方法忘了。分成两步嘛,先开一个指针数组,然后对每个数组元素再开一维数组

2)写着写着free就给忘了。。。

3)memset第二个参数是char类型,这就是为什么对其他数据类型只能做清零操作的原因

4)找最小的rank的时候逻辑非常不清晰,盲目写代码,最忌讳的就是这点,还总掉进去。。。

5)读题不认真,1007问题已经指明了N个国家中只对M个进行排序,1324也清楚的显示了优先级是ACME,

我却想当然的按照输入顺序CMEA来做,能AC就怪了。。。

1009就一个地方,原始的二叉搜索树的根节点因为要重复使用(想当然认为一组case就一个数据),第二次使用之前保留了第一次的垃圾值,

导致了RE,这个问题很严重,要养成指针使用之前初始化的习惯才行。。。

这三道题的代码就不贴了,太糟糕,总之要吸取教训,继续提高编码能力。。。Fighting !!!

抱歉!评论已关闭.